As the number of vehicle thefts continues to increase in Vancouver the VPD announced a new initiative today aimed at reducing them.

Through their 'Use It' program they're offering free steering wheel locks to Vancouver residents who own vehicles that don't have anti-theft technology.

Funding is coming from ICBC and the Vancouver Police Foundation charity.

They're available at these community policing centres (CPC):

· Collingwood CPC – 5160 Joyce Street

· Hastings Sunrise CPC – 2620 East Hastings Street

· Kitsilano-Fairview CPC – unit 78, 1687 West Broadway Avenue

· Granville Downtown CPC – 1263 Granville Street
